Output faf625feaee0272c47a8b8c2e532aa39b63673c75c13de3118578928c92ee0a1:1

value
315197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 074954657a868fcaa76575e8828252413f8907a2 OP_EQUAL
address
32MYVvQWkm539e2P7SmvxosWiDu67EvCor
transaction
faf625feaee0272c47a8b8c2e532aa39b63673c75c13de3118578928c92ee0a1
spent
true